NASA Roman Space Telescope’s Antenna, ‘Visor’ Deployed

NASA's Nancy Grace Roman Space Telescope has successfully deployed its antenna and visor-like sunshade. This high-gain antenna, measuring 5.6 feet wide and weighing only 24 pounds, is made of a lightweight carbon composite material. Despite its small size, the antenna is designed to withstand extreme temperature fluctuations during the spacecraft's journey across a million miles of space.

The antenna will transmit data back to Earth at a rate of up to 500 megabits per second, using two frequencies. One frequency will allow the spacecraft to receive commands, while the other will enable the transmission of high-volume data. The antenna deployment took about 4 minutes and concluded on August 31 at 2:03 p.m. EDT. Following the antenna deployment, the deployable aperture cover, a large sunshade designed to prevent unwanted light from entering the telescope, was released.

Deploying via three booms, the cover took approximately 8 minutes to unfurl and was successfully completed on September 1 at 6:05 a.m. EDT. Roman's next significant milestone is the activation of its Coronagraph Instrument, followed by the Wide Field Instrument. Both instruments will undergo a series of calibrations and tests throughout the spacecraft's three-month commissioning period.
